Power generation and distribution companies worldwide rely on HDG lattice structures for their transmission network backbone. Electrical utilities deploy these towers for primary transmission routes carrying high-voltage lines between substations and across challenging terrains. Renewable energy projects utilize them for connecting solar farms and wind turbines to the main grid infrastructure. Industrial complexes install these structures for dedicated power supply lines to manufacturing facilities, while telecommunications companies adapt them for co-locating fiber optic cables alongside electrical conductors.
